Given logx 2=p and logx 7=q , express log7 4x² in terms of p and q​
kodGreya [7K]

Answer:

[2(p + 1)]/q

Step-by-step explanation:

logx 2 = p

logx 7 = q

log7 4x² = log7 (2x)²

= (logx (2x)²)/(logx 7)

= (2 logx 2x)/(logx 7)

= (2 logx 2 + 2 logx x)/(logx 7)

= (2p + 2)/q

= [2(p + 1)]/q
